> Yep, sure is. Here's an excerpt from the (Gnu tar 1.12) man page...
> --------------------------------------------------
> -y, --bzip2, --bunzip2
> filter the archive through bzip2
> --------------------------------------------------
>
> If your copy of tar doesn't support it, perhaps you could get hold of the
> source and compile it with bzip2 support.
